Suggestions These are my 3 suggestions to guarantee you a memorable and exciting visit to Montevideo: 1. Montevideo is a safe city, although I would recommend you to take care of your personal belongings. If you are planning to stay some days choose a hotel in coastal neighborhoods as Punta Carretas, or Pocitos where the beaches and our beautiful rambla are the main highlight of Montevideo the Seaside City. If after your visit you are leaving Uruguay early in the morning I suggest to stay in the Carrasco neighborhood next to Carrasco Airport. 2. Major credit cards are accepted, Money exchange shops and ATM are everywhere. Dollars are widely accepted. 3. Water and food quality have the same standards as USA or Europe. In restaurants, customers are charged around 3 dollars as "Table Fee". Restaurants beverages (soft drinks, wine, beer and coffee) are quite expensive. Tipping is optional, usually 10%. Overview of your Montevideo tour

Jewish came to America since Columbus first trip , in his ship, was Yosef Ha Levy Haivri who changed his name to Luis de Torres . European immigrants , were first Spaniards, , and around 1900's Jewish emigrants from Russia and Turkey. Eastern Europe and Germany. Some arrived in Argentina in 19th Century helped by Baron Hirsh to became farmer settlers. Downtown Montevideo Neighborhood had areas as the Lower East Side of NY in the 1920's. We will visit the outdoor Holocaust Memorial near seaside, the only Memorial in South America. See the photos. I will tell you personal anecdotes about my family stories characteristics of our Community . We will also visit some Montevideo highlights such as the Old City area, the Old Sephardic Synagogue (closed). The Independence Square, and Salvo Palace, 18 de Julio main Avenue, and the Parliament.
